Interesting Facts
- Every 68 seconds somebody is diagnosed with Alzheimer's, by 2050 every 33 seconds somebody will be diagnosed with Alzheimer's
- More women have Alzheimer's than men
- In 2013 the direct costs of Alzheimer's disease care to American Society was approximately 203 billion dollars.
- The more education you receive in old age will decrease your risk of getting Alzheimer's
- A German doctor named Alois Alzheimer first observed Alzheimer's in 1906 when a patient had it and died from it, he looked at some parts of the brain and noted they had shrunken. A psychiatrist of his named the disease in 1910.
- Alzheimer's patients may start to lose their sense of smell
